Prime Minister Le Minh Hung meets with foreign leaders in New Delhi

VGP - Prime Minister Le Minh Hung met with Russian President Vladimir Putin, Indonesian President Prabowo Subianto, Philippine President Ferdinand R. Marcos Jr., Malaysian Prime Minister Anwar Ibrahim, United Nations Secretary-General António Guterres, and World Health Organization (WHO) Director-General Tedros Adhanom Ghebreyesus on the sidelines of the 18th BRICS Summit in New Delhi on September 13 (local time).

At his meeting with Russian President Vladimir Putin, Prime Minister Le Minh Hung expressed his sincere appreciation to President Putin, the Russian Government and people for their warm, thoughtful and cordial reception during the highly successful recent State visit to Russia by General Secretary and President To Lam and his spouse. 

He affirmed that the Vietnamese Government would direct ministries and sectors to promptly implement the important outcomes of the visit and translate them into specific and practical cooperation programs at an early date.

President Vladimir Putin expressed his delight at the outcomes of the State visit by General Secretary and President To Lam and his spouse, expressing his belief that the agreements reached would be effectively implemented, thereby contributing to further advancing the Viet Nam-Russia comprehensive strategic partnership.

At his meetings with leaders of countries and international organizations, Prime Minister Le Minh Hung discussed a number of important issues aimed at promoting and deepening Viet Nam's relations with these countries and partners across various fields.

Leaders of the countries and international organizations spoke highly of Viet Nam's socio-economic development achievements and expressed their appreciation of and desire to further promote substantive and effective relations with Viet Nam.

The Presidents of Indonesia and the Philippines, the Prime Minister of Malaysia and Prime Minister Le Minh Hung agreed to continue close coordination and contribute to the success of ASEAN Year 2026, under the chairmanship of the Philippines.

UN Secretary-General António Guterres highly valued Viet Nam's increasingly prominent role and position, and expressed his hope that Viet Nam would continue to play an active role and make positive contributions to upholding multilateralism and addressing global challenges.

WHO Director-General Tedros Adhanom Ghebreyesus spoke highly of Viet Nam's new orientations and policies on developing its healthcare system, affirming that WHO stands ready to coordinate with and accompany Viet Nam in successfully achieving its goals of developing the healthcare system, as well as its set targets for sustainable socio-economic development.

The meetings and exchanges between Prime Minister Le Minh Hung and leaders of countries and international organizations contributed to strengthening political trust, promoting bilateral cooperation, enhancing coordination at multilateral forums, thereby creating further momentum for Viet Nam's relations with its partners in favor of national development./.
